Abstract: We usually think of the circus and the ideas associated to it, with something childish and cheerful, or with a sense of happiness, amazement and admiration. However, as we age, this perception changes, and the feelings that are bound to it transform into the complete opposite. In this report we will look at the image of the clown represented in the artworks of different generations of Bulgarian graphic artists. We will try to follow the evolution of that image over time, as well as look for the connection between the author and the social reality, and the artist’s reason to turn to the particular allegorical statement.
